Can a person's judicial records be obtained if they have been the victim of a homicide crime in Ecuador?
In general, judicial records are not obtained specifically for people who have been victims of a homicide crime in Ecuador. In cases of homicide, the competent authorities, such as the State Attorney General's Office and the National Police, are responsible for investigating and prosecuting those responsible for this serious crime. Victims and their families can collaborate with authorities by providing information and testimony, but they are not issued a criminal record as a result of their status as victims.
What are the civil sanctions for a food debtor in Chile?
Civil sanctions for a food debtor in Chile include fines and the seizure of their assets to cover the food debt. These sanctions can be imposed by the court in case of non-compliance.
